problems with dwg text import

whenever i open a ACAD .dgw file with Autosketech 7.0 some text blocks are not correct, the look like %db("3")whats the problem, whats the solution. If i open the same file with a dwg fiewer - everything is correct.

thank you for your help - Reinhard

They are AutoCAD created attributes....they
will not transfer across into AS.
